Theme Prestashop : 20 problèmes et solutions pour corriger
Thème PrestaShop : 20 Problèmes et Solutions
Sommaire
- Le thème PrestaShop ne s'installe pas correctement
- Problème d'affichage du thème PrestaShop après installation
- Erreur "Le thème n'est pas compatible avec votre version de PrestaShop"
- Les modifications du thème PrestaShop ne s'affichent pas
- Problème de lenteur lié au thème PrestaShop
- Les traductions du thème PrestaShop ne fonctionnent pas
- Le thème PrestaShop n'est pas responsive sur mobile
- Problème de compatibilité entre le thème et les modules PrestaShop
- Les fichiers CSS du thème PrestaShop ne sont pas pris en compte
- Erreur avec les images du thème PrestaShop
- Problème d'affichage du menu principal avec le thème PrestaShop
- Problème avec les polices du thème PrestaShop
- Le thème PrestaShop ne s'affiche pas correctement après une mise à jour
- Problème de personnalisation du thème PrestaShop
- Erreur "Template non trouvé" pour le thème PrestaShop
- Problème avec la version multiboutique et le thème PrestaShop
- Le thème PrestaShop n'affiche pas les déclinaisons de produits
- Problème avec le pied de page du thème PrestaShop
- Erreur "Hooks manquants" lors de l'installation du thème PrestaShop
- Problème de performance lié au thème PrestaShop
1. Le thème PrestaShop ne s'installe pas correctement
Le thème PrestaShop peut ne pas s'installer correctement si le fichier ZIP est corrompu, incomplet ou incompatible avec votre version de PrestaShop. Cela peut entraîner une erreur lors du téléchargement ou de l'installation. Pour résoudre ce problème, vérifiez que le fichier ZIP contient bien les dossiers obligatoires comme /templates
, /assets
et /config
.
Assurez-vous également que votre version de PrestaShop est compatible avec le thème. Si vous utilisez un thème téléchargé depuis une source externe, privilégiez des plateformes fiables comme la marketplace officielle de PrestaShop pour éviter les fichiers défectueux. Enfin, assurez-vous que les permissions des dossiers de votre boutique permettent l'installation du thème (755 pour les dossiers, 644 pour les fichiers).
2. Problème d'affichage du thème PrestaShop après installation
Un thème PrestaShop peut ne pas s'afficher correctement après son installation en raison d'un problème de cache ou de conflits avec des modules existants. Les erreurs courantes incluent des pages vides ou un mauvais rendu graphique. Pour corriger cela, videz le cache de votre boutique dans "Paramètres Avancés > Performances" et désactivez le cache Smarty temporairement.
Si le problème persiste, vérifiez que tous les modules nécessaires au fonctionnement du thème sont bien installés et activés. Testez également avec le thème Classic pour confirmer que le problème vient du thème installé et non de la configuration globale de PrestaShop.
3. Erreur "Le thème n'est pas compatible avec votre version de PrestaShop"
Cette erreur peut apparaître si le thème que vous essayez d'installer est conçu pour une version différente de PrestaShop. Cela peut bloquer son installation ou entraîner des dysfonctionnements dans le front-office. Pour résoudre ce problème, vérifiez la compatibilité du thème avec votre version de PrestaShop en consultant la documentation ou en contactant le développeur du thème.
Si aucune mise à jour du thème n'est disponible, vous pouvez tenter de l'adapter manuellement en modifiant les fichiers du thème, bien que cela nécessite des connaissances techniques. Utiliser un thème à jour et compatible garantit une expérience utilisateur fluide et sans erreurs.
4. Les modifications du thème PrestaShop ne s'affichent pas
Lorsque vous apportez des modifications à un thème PrestaShop, celles-ci peuvent ne pas apparaître en raison du système de cache activé. Cela peut inclure des changements dans le CSS, les images ou la disposition des pages. Pour résoudre cela, désactivez le cache Smarty dans "Paramètres Avancés > Performances" et forcez la compilation des fichiers.
Assurez-vous également que les modifications sont bien effectuées dans le dossier correct (par exemple, dans le dossier de votre thème actif) et non dans un fichier temporaire ou erroné. Une fois les modifications testées, réactivez le cache pour optimiser les performances de votre boutique.
5. Problème de lenteur lié au thème PrestaShop
Certains thèmes PrestaShop peuvent ralentir votre boutique s'ils contiennent des fichiers non optimisés ou un trop grand nombre de fonctionnalités inutiles. Cela peut entraîner un temps de chargement élevé pour les visiteurs. Pour résoudre ce problème, désactivez les modules ou fonctionnalités non essentiels inclus dans le thème.
Activez également les options d'optimisation dans "Paramètres Avancés > Performances", comme la compression CSS/JS et la mise en cache. Si le problème persiste, contactez le développeur du thème pour signaler les lenteurs ou envisagez de passer à un thème plus léger et optimisé. Une boutique rapide améliore l'expérience utilisateur et booste votre SEO.
6. Les traductions du thème PrestaShop ne fonctionnent pas
Si les traductions du thème PrestaShop ne s'affichent pas, cela peut être dû à des fichiers de langue manquants ou à une mauvaise configuration dans l'administration. Pour résoudre cela, allez dans "International > Traductions", sélectionnez votre thème dans la liste, et vérifiez les chaînes de texte à traduire.
Si des traductions sont manquantes, vous pouvez les ajouter manuellement ou vérifier que les fichiers de traduction (par exemple, fr.php
pour le français) existent dans le dossier /themes/votre-theme/translations
. Des traductions complètes garantissent une expérience utilisateur adaptée pour toutes les langues de votre boutique.
7. Le thème PrestaShop n'est pas responsive sur mobile
Un thème non responsive peut poser problème sur les appareils mobiles, avec des éléments mal positionnés ou un design non optimisé. Cela peut impacter l'expérience utilisateur et réduire vos conversions. Pour résoudre ce problème, vérifiez si le thème est conçu pour être responsive. Si ce n'est pas le cas, utilisez un thème compatible mobile ou appliquez des ajustements CSS avec des media queries.
Testez votre site avec des outils comme Google Mobile-Friendly Test pour identifier les problèmes spécifiques et ajustez les styles en conséquence. Une boutique responsive garantit une navigation fluide pour les utilisateurs mobiles, qui représentent une part importante du trafic e-commerce.
8. Problème de compatibilité entre le thème et les modules PrestaShop
Certains modules PrestaShop peuvent ne pas fonctionner correctement avec un thème personnalisé en raison de différences dans les hooks ou le design. Cela peut entraîner des erreurs ou un affichage incorrect des fonctionnalités liées aux modules. Pour résoudre ce problème, vérifiez si votre thème prend en charge les hooks utilisés par le module. Accédez à "Conception > Positions des modules" et assurez-vous que le module est bien attaché aux bons hooks.
Si le problème persiste, contactez le développeur du thème ou du module pour obtenir une mise à jour ou une solution personnalisée. Une bonne compatibilité entre les thèmes et les modules est essentielle pour garantir un fonctionnement fluide et complet de votre boutique.
9. Les fichiers CSS du thème PrestaShop ne sont pas pris en compte
Si les fichiers CSS du thème ne sont pas pris en compte, cela peut être dû au système de cache de PrestaShop ou à une mauvaise structure du fichier CSS. Cela peut entraîner un affichage désordonné de votre boutique. Pour résoudre cela, désactivez le cache Smarty dans "Paramètres Avancés > Performances" et forcez la compilation des fichiers.
Vérifiez également que les fichiers CSS sont bien référencés dans le fichier header.tpl
ou le theme.css
de votre thème. Si nécessaire, videz manuellement le cache dans le dossier /var/cache/
. Des fichiers CSS bien configurés garantissent un design cohérent et fonctionnel pour votre boutique.
10. Erreur avec les images du thème PrestaShop
Les images du thème peuvent ne pas s'afficher correctement si elles ne sont pas présentes dans les bons dossiers ou si les permissions des fichiers sont incorrectes. Cela peut entraîner des images manquantes ou cassées dans le front-office. Pour résoudre ce problème, vérifiez que les images du thème sont bien placées dans le dossier /themes/votre-theme/assets/img/
.
Assurez-vous également que les permissions des fichiers sont correctement configurées (755 pour les dossiers et 644 pour les fichiers). Si les images sont toujours manquantes, régénérez les miniatures dans "Paramètres > Images". Une gestion soignée des images garantit une présentation visuelle professionnelle de votre boutique.
11. Problème d'affichage du menu principal avec le thème PrestaShop
Le menu principal peut ne pas s'afficher correctement avec certains thèmes en raison de conflits CSS ou d'une mauvaise configuration des modules. Cela peut entraîner un mauvais positionnement des éléments ou un menu incomplet. Pour résoudre cela, vérifiez les paramètres du module de menu dans "Modules > Gestion des modules". Assurez-vous que les catégories et sous-catégories sont bien assignées et actives.
Si le problème persiste, inspectez le fichier header.tpl
de votre thème pour vérifier que le code du menu est bien présent. Si nécessaire, appliquez des ajustements CSS pour corriger l'affichage. Un menu fonctionnel et bien présenté améliore la navigation et l'expérience utilisateur.
12. Problème avec les polices du thème PrestaShop
Les polices du thème peuvent ne pas s'afficher correctement si elles ne sont pas bien intégrées ou si les fichiers de polices sont manquants. Cela peut entraîner une présentation incohérente du texte sur votre boutique. Pour résoudre cela, vérifiez que les fichiers de polices sont bien placés dans le dossier /themes/votre-theme/assets/fonts/
.
Si vous utilisez des polices Google, assurez-vous que les liens vers les polices sont bien ajoutés dans le fichier header.tpl
ou theme.css
. Si les polices ne s'affichent toujours pas, testez avec un navigateur différent pour identifier les problèmes liés au cache ou aux compatibilités. Des polices bien configurées garantissent une présentation esthétique et professionnelle de votre boutique.
13. Le thème PrestaShop ne s'affiche pas correctement après une mise à jour
Après une mise à jour de PrestaShop, votre thème peut rencontrer des problèmes d'affichage si des fichiers ou des hooks ne sont plus compatibles avec la nouvelle version. Cela peut entraîner des erreurs ou des fonctionnalités manquantes. Pour résoudre ce problème, vérifiez que votre thème est compatible avec la version mise à jour de PrestaShop.
Si ce n'est pas le cas, contactez le développeur du thème pour obtenir une mise à jour. Si vous ne pouvez pas obtenir de correctif, envisagez de revenir à une version précédente de PrestaShop ou de passer à un thème plus récent et compatible.
14. Problème de personnalisation du thème PrestaShop
La personnalisation d'un thème PrestaShop peut être limitée si le thème ne propose pas d'options flexibles dans son interface. Cela peut empêcher de modifier facilement les couleurs, les polices ou les dispositions. Pour résoudre ce problème, vérifiez les options de personnalisation disponibles dans "Conception > Thèmes > Personnaliser".
Si les options sont insuffisantes, éditez manuellement les fichiers CSS ou les fichiers .tpl
pour appliquer les modifications souhaitées. Si vous manquez de compétences techniques, envisagez d'utiliser un module de personnalisation ou de changer de thème pour un modèle plus flexible.
15. Erreur "Template non trouvé" pour le thème PrestaShop
L'erreur "Template non trouvé" se produit généralement si un fichier .tpl
essentiel manque dans le dossier du thème. Cela peut entraîner une page blanche ou une erreur critique. Pour corriger cela, vérifiez que tous les fichiers nécessaires sont présents dans le dossier /themes/votre-theme/templates/
.
Si un fichier manque, restaurez le thème à partir de la sauvegarde ou téléchargez une version propre du thème depuis la source d'origine. Une structure de fichiers complète garantit que le thème fonctionne sans erreurs.
16. Problème avec la version multiboutique et le thème PrestaShop
En mode multiboutique, un thème peut ne pas s'appliquer correctement à toutes les boutiques si les paramètres ne sont pas bien configurés. Cela peut entraîner des incohérences dans l'affichage. Pour résoudre cela, allez dans "Conception > Thèmes" et appliquez le thème souhaité individuellement pour chaque boutique.
Vérifiez également que chaque boutique utilise les bonnes traductions et configurations de modules. Une configuration adaptée garantit une expérience cohérente sur toutes vos boutiques.
17. Le thème PrestaShop n'affiche pas les déclinaisons de produits
Si les déclinaisons de produits ne s'affichent pas correctement, cela peut être dû à une incompatibilité avec le thème ou à des paramètres incorrects. Vérifiez que les attributs des produits sont bien configurés dans "Catalogue > Attributs et Valeurs".
Ensuite, testez l'affichage des déclinaisons avec le thème Classic. Si elles apparaissent correctement, le problème vient de votre thème personnalisé. Appliquez les correctifs nécessaires dans les fichiers .tpl
ou contactez le développeur du thème.
18. Problème avec le pied de page du thème PrestaShop
Le pied de page d'un thème peut ne pas s'afficher correctement si les modules assignés aux hooks correspondants ne sont pas activés. Pour corriger cela, allez dans "Conception > Positions des modules" et assurez-vous que les modules nécessaires sont attachés au hook displayFooter
.
Si le problème persiste, vérifiez le fichier footer.tpl
de votre thème pour vous assurer que le code du pied de page est bien présent. Une configuration correcte garantit un pied de page fonctionnel et professionnel.
19. Erreur "Hooks manquants" lors de l'installation du thème PrestaShop
Cette erreur apparaît si le thème que vous installez nécessite des hooks spécifiques qui ne sont pas activés ou disponibles dans votre installation. Pour corriger cela, vérifiez la documentation du thème pour identifier les hooks requis. Créez les hooks manquants via "Paramètres Avancés > Positions des modules" si nécessaire.
Si vous ne savez pas comment les ajouter, contactez le développeur du thème pour obtenir une assistance. Une gestion correcte des hooks garantit que toutes les fonctionnalités du thème fonctionnent comme prévu.
20. Problème de performance lié au thème PrestaShop
Un thème mal optimisé peut ralentir votre boutique en raison de fichiers CSS/JS non compressés ou d'images lourdes. Pour résoudre ce problème, activez la compression CSS et JavaScript dans "Paramètres Avancés > Performances". Utilisez également des outils comme TinyPNG pour compresser vos images.
Si le problème persiste, envisagez de changer de thème ou d'utiliser un module de performance pour optimiser votre boutique. Une boutique rapide garantit une meilleure expérience utilisateur et améliore vos conversions.